Lady Gaga arrived at the 2023 Oscars looking incredible in a straight-off-the-runway Versace gown, and naturally, the second she showed up everyone stopped in their tracks to scream her name/photograph her. But right in the middle of Gaga walking the not-red carpet in movie star mode, she noticed a photographer fall over, then stopped what she was doing, and rushed to help him.

Reminder that Gaga is performing her Top Gun: Maverick song “Hold My Hand” during tonight’s show, despite reports that she wouldn’t be.

Oscars executive producer Glenn Weiss actually previously confirmed that Gaga wouldn’t be performing, saying, “We invited all five nominees. We have a great relationship with Lady Gaga and her camp. She is in the middle of shooting a movie right now. Here, we are honoring the movie industry and what it takes to make a movie after a bunch of back and forth…It didn’t feel like she can get a performance to the caliber that we’re used to with her and that she is used to. So she is not going to perform on the show.”
